Synopsis: ArcelorMittal secures major rail supply contract for Oman-UAE cross-border railway project, marking significant infrastructure milestone connecting Gulf Cooperation Council nations through advanced transportation networks.

Strategic Synergies: Sectoral Supremacy & Sovereign Solidarity ArcelorMittal has achieved a momentous commercial triumph by securing the rail supply contract for the groundbreaking Oman-UAE cross-border railway project, representing a pivotal milestone in Gulf Cooperation Council infrastructure development & regional economic integration initiatives. This transformative project encompasses the construction of a comprehensive railway network that will physically connect Oman & the United Arab Emirates, facilitating unprecedented levels of trade, tourism, & economic cooperation between these strategically important Middle Eastern nations. The railway infrastructure represents far more than mere transportation connectivity, embodying broader regional ambitions for economic diversification, logistics optimization, & strategic positioning within global trade networks that increasingly prioritize efficient multimodal transportation solutions. ArcelorMittal's selection as the primary rail supplier reflects the company's exceptional technical capabilities, proven track record in demanding infrastructure projects, & comprehensive understanding of the unique challenges associated regarding railway construction in harsh desert environments. The project's strategic significance extends beyond bilateral cooperation to encompass broader Gulf Cooperation Council integration objectives that seek to create seamless transportation networks facilitating regional economic development & enhanced competitiveness in global markets. Industry analysts estimate the total project value at approximately $3 billion, regarding ArcelorMittal's rail supply component representing a substantial portion of this investment, potentially generating revenues exceeding $200 million over the project lifecycle. The cross-border railway initiative aligns perfectly regarding both nations' Vision 2030 strategic development plans, which emphasize infrastructure modernization, economic diversification, & regional connectivity as fundamental pillars of sustainable long-term growth. "This project represents a historic milestone in regional connectivity & demonstrates our commitment to supporting transformative infrastructure development across the Middle East," stated Aditya Mittal, Chief Executive Officer of ArcelorMittal, during the contract announcement ceremony in Abu Dhabi.

Technical Triumphs: Tubular Technologies & Terrestrial Tenacity The rail specifications for the Oman-UAE cross-border railway project demand exceptional technical performance characteristics capable of withstanding the extreme environmental conditions prevalent in the Arabian Peninsula, including intense heat, sandstorms, & significant temperature fluctuations that challenge conventional railway materials. ArcelorMittal's technical solution encompasses advanced steel formulations, specialized heat treatment processes, & innovative coating technologies designed to optimize performance, durability, & maintenance requirements throughout the railway's operational lifecycle. The rails incorporate proprietary metallurgical compositions that enhance resistance to thermal expansion, corrosion, & wear patterns typically associated regarding heavy freight & passenger operations in desert environments. Manufacturing specifications include precise dimensional tolerances, advanced welding compatibility, & specialized surface treatments that ensure optimal performance regarding modern high-speed rolling stock & heavy freight applications planned for this strategic transportation corridor. The technical requirements also encompass comprehensive quality assurance protocols, including advanced testing procedures, material certification processes, & performance validation systems that guarantee compliance regarding international railway standards & regional regulatory requirements.
